,可以使用版本控制系统中的diff命令来实现。diff命令可以比较两个文件的内容,并生成差异行的列表。
diff命令的基本用法是:
diff 文件1 文件2
该命令会比较文件1和文件2的内容,并输出差异行的列表。
差异行列表的格式通常是以行号和行内容的形式展示,表示两个文件在该行的内容不同。例如:
1c1
< This is the original text.
---
> This is the modified text.
在这个例子中,1c1
表示第一个文件的第一行与第二个文件的第一行不同。<
表示第一个文件的内容,---
表示差异的分隔符,>
表示第二个文件的内容。
根据差异行列表,可以进行一些操作,比如生成补丁文件、合并文件等。
在云计算领域,差异行列表的应用场景包括代码版本控制、文件同步、文档比较等。通过比较差异行列表,可以快速了解两个文件之间的差异,方便开发人员进行代码合并、文件同步等操作。
腾讯云提供了一款与差异行列表相关的产品,即腾讯云代码托管(CodeCommit)。CodeCommit是一种安全、高度可扩展的托管代码存储服务,支持团队协作开发、版本控制、代码审查等功能。通过CodeCommit,开发人员可以方便地比较文件差异、查看差异行列表,并进行代码合并、版本管理等操作。
更多关于腾讯云代码托管的信息,可以访问以下链接: 腾讯云代码托管(CodeCommit)
领取专属 10元无门槛券
手把手带您无忧上云